Part 3: Flashing the Updated V23

  1. Deselect "Erase Flash" and "Erase Bootloader" if you only want to fix software glitches.
  2. Select "Force Erase All" if you are recovering from a boot loop (recommended).
  3. Click Start.
  4. Crucial: Do not touch the cable. The bar will progress: [0%] -> [7%] (DDR init) -> [56%] (System write) -> [94%] (Data write).
  5. When you see "Burn Complete" in green text, click Stop.
  6. Unplug the USB cable and the power cable. Wait 10 seconds. Plug power back in.

Part 5: Post-Update Checklist – What to Do After R29 is Installed

Your MXQ LP3 V23 will boot into a fresh Android setup screen. Immediately perform these steps:

  1. Skip Google login (do it after WiFi is confirmed stable).
  2. Check WiFi: Go to network settings. If WiFi toggles on and finds networks, the driver update succeeded.
  3. Install a launcher: The R29 firmware often includes a basic launcher. Install ATV Launcher or Wolf Launcher for a cleaner interface.
  4. Disable automatic updates: Go to Play Store settings and disable auto-update – some app updates break compatibility with R29.
  5. Root verification: Download Root Checker. Most R29 builds come pre-rooted. If not, you can flash Magisk via the updated bootloader.
